Printing Contract Dispute Case Involving a Fujian Printing Company and Its Client
Case Summary
Plaintiff Xiamen [Name] Printing Co., Ltd. entered into a "Printing Services Contract" with Defendant Fujian [Brand Name] Design Co., Ltd. The contract stipulated that Plaintiff would print promotional brochures and packaging boxes for Defendant at a total price of 36 ten thousand yuan. Payment was due upon acceptance after delivery, provided the products matched the proof approved by Defendant. Plaintiff completed all printing work according to the approved proofs and delivered the full order. After receipt, Defendant paid only 10 ten thousand yuan in printing fees, refusing to pay the remaining 26 ten thousand yuan on grounds that the color and craftsmanship did not meet requirements. Plaintiff filed suit requesting payment of the outstanding balance and liquidated damages.

Processing Result
The court ruled that the Defendant shall pay the Plaintiff the remaining printing fees of 26 ten thousand yuan, plus liquidated damages for overdue payment calculated at a rate of 0.03% per day on the principal amount of 26 ten thousand yuan, from the due date until the date of actual payment in full; and the Defendant shall bear all litigation costs of this case.
